Sign In — Free (10 views/day)THE BOONVILLE COMMUNITY, founded in 1958, is a small nonprofit in the Public Safety sector that reported $371K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ue decreased 16%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$423K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 14% operating deficit.
TO PROVIDE FIREFIGHTING AND FIRE PREVENTION TO THE BOONVILLE COUNTY
